Can I retrieve my old data from the MacintoshPlus or Micronet hd?

My first computer, a Macintosh Plus was connected to MicroNet hard drives and they worked for a long time and printed to an ancient ImageWriter. But the Macintosh Plus/Micronet set up recently failed and the old MacWrite files cannot be retrieved. I would like to retrieve some personally important data. The data is also present on a floppy disk (in a MacWrite application). Can you help me?
